Default my computer's acting weird

My computer has been acting weird for about a week now. I posted a hijack this log here with no luck. I tried to scan my computer on line at Trend. It came up negative. Also at the beginnig of the scan I am prompted to restart my puter to completely clean the trojan, exactly as it did the last time I was infected. I also downloaded AVG and tried a scan with negative results. I'm not sure if that is effective if the virus is present before the install or not. Any advice on this matter would be great.

Tools for killing spyware are:

start with an online virus check Yes you may have the latest and greatest but often these are blocked so that they appear to work but are not. Online checks cannot be blocked. If you can't get to the online page you have either got a java problem or big worries.

spybot Must be updated as soon as its installed.

adaware Must be updated as soon as its installed.

spyware blasterRun this as a further check[/url]

bhodaemon Use this to see what "helper objects" are not very helpful.

Hijack this Gives you a list and lets you decide what to kill.

cwshredder gets cool web search and its variants


Now the tricky bit is to work out what you don't want.

Where possible run these in safe mode (press f8 just before windows starts loading)
First, disconnect from the internet and if you have a network, unplug the network cable. This will prevent cross-infecting from other machines or the internet feeding you more problems.

Run spybot to kill most things automatically
Run adaware to see if spybot missed anything
Run bhodaemon and look up whether you want those bhos
Run hikack this, make a note of any .exe or .dll or .cab files, check the ones you want fixed and click the fix button. Now go on a search and destroy mission on of your own. Make sure you can see hidden and system files (my computer, folder options,view for xp or my computer, view, folder options, view for 9x) Find each file and delete it - either to the recycle bin and then empty it or press and hold shift and hit the delete key.

If files will not let you delete them, you may have to turn off a service in xp/2k and end a process tree, or in 9x/me press ctrl, alt,del and end task.

Now use the immunise function in spybot to stop those **** things installing again.

Only reboot to normal mode when you feel sure you got it all. If you didn't you make get it straight back again.

There are a few more of these utils - I am sure people will add to the list.

pestpatrol has a library of spyware with explanations The product is commercial, but the info is free.

You will also need some sort of winsock /lsp fix if certain spyware is removed the wrong way. When this happens you will know, because you wont get on the internet and nothing you do will make a difference.

winsockfix

winsock2 fix

lsp fix
